What People on Dialysis Say About Phosphorus and Kidney Transplantation
Key takeaways
The National Kidney Foundation asked people on dialysis how they manage phosphorus, a mineral that builds up in the blood when kidneys fail. It also asked whether their care team talked about phosphorus while checking whether they could get a kidney transplant. Many people wonder if high phosphorus could hurt their chances of getting a transplant. This is a foundation staff article, not a published study, and the excerpt gives no numbers or results yet.
